Goldman Sachs Group Inc. Has $482.07 Million Stock Holdings in The Allstate Corporation (NYSE:ALL)

Allstate logo with Finance background

Goldman Sachs Group Inc. grew its stake in shares of The Allstate Corporation (NYSE:ALL - Free Report) by 27.2% during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 2,328,070 shares of the insurance provider's stock after purchasing an additional 497,982 shares during the quarter. Goldman Sachs Group Inc. owned about 0.88% of Allstate worth $482,073,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Allstate Trading Down 2.0%

Shares of NYSE:ALL opened at $204.86 on Friday. The business's 50 day simple moving average is $198.37 and its 200 day simple moving average is $197.65. The Allstate Corporation has a 1 year low of $169.20 and a 1 year high of $213.18.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.37, a current ratio of 0.43 and a quick ratio of 0.43. The company has a market capitalization of $53.98 billion, a P/E ratio of 9.63, a P/E/G ratio of 0.87 and a beta of 0.35.

Allstate (NYSE:ALL -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The insurance provider reported $5.94 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$3.20 by $2.74. The company had revenue of $15.05 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$16.59 billion. Allstate had a return on equity of 28.74% and a net margin of 8.79%. Allstate's quarterly revenue was up 5.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$1.61 EPS. On average, research analysts anticipate that The Allstate Corporation will post 18.74 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Allstate Announces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, October 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, August 29th will be given a $1.00 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Friday, August 29th. This represents a $4.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.0%. Allstate's payout ratio is presently 18.81%.

Allstate Profile

(Free Report)

The Allstate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, provides property and casualty, and other insurance products in the United States and Canada. It operates in five segments: Allstate Protection; Protection Services; Allstate Health and Benefits; Run-off Property-Liability; and Corporate and Other segments.
